{ "info": { "author": "Micah Hausler", "author_email": "opensource@ambition.com", "bugtrack_url": null, "classifiers": [ "Intended Audience :: Developers", "License :: OSI Approved :: MIT License", "Operating System :: OS Independent",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.3", "Programming Language :: Python :: 3.4" ], "description": ".. image:: https://travis-ci.org/ambitioninc/python-logentries-api.png\n :target: https://travis-ci.org/ambitioninc/python-logentries-api\n\n.. image:: https://coveralls.io/repos/ambitioninc/python-logentries-api/badge.png?branch=master\n :target: https://coveralls.io/r/ambitioninc/python-logentries-api?branch=master\n\npython-logentries-api\n=====================\nThis is a Python wrapper for the Logentries API. The API object terms follow\nthe semantics from the Logentries website, not the Logentries API.\n\nThe `InactivityAlert`_ and `AnomalyAlert`_ classes simulate a user login to\ncreate the appropriate alerts.\n\n.. _AnomalyAlert: http://python-logentries-api.readthedocs.org/en/latest/ref/special_alerts.html#anomalyalert\n.. _InactivityAlert: http://python-logentries-api.readthedocs.org/en/latest/ref/special_alerts.html#inactivityalert\n\nThis is not endorsed or provided by Logentries, and no commercial support is\nprovided.\n\nExample\n-------\n\nTo create a new tag called 'user_agent = curl' and associate it with a log\ncalled 'someset/somelog':\n\n::\n\n from logentries_api import Tags, Hooks, Labels, LogSets\n\n label = Labels().create('user_agent = curl')\n log = LogSets().get('someset/somelog')\n tag = Tags().create(label['sn'])\n hook = Hooks().create(\n name=label['title'],\n regexes=['user_agent = /curl\\/[\\d.]*/'],\n tag_id=tag['id'],\n logs=[log['key']]\n )\n\n\nInstallation\n------------\nTo install the latest release, type::\n\n pip install python-logentries-api\n\nTo install the latest code directly from source, type::\n\n pip install git+git://github.com/ambitioninc/python-logentries-api.git\n\nDocumentation\n-------------\n\nFull documentation is available at http://python-logentries-api.readthedocs.org\n\nLicense\n-------\nMIT License (see LICENSE)",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/ambitioninc/python-logentries-api", "keywords": "logs,logentries", "license": "MIT", "maintainer": null, "maintainer_email": null, "name": "python-logentries-api", "package_url": "https://pypi.org/project/python-logentries-api/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/python-logentries-api/", "project_urls": { "Download": "UNKNOWN", "Homepage": "https://github.com/ambitioninc/python-logentries-api" }, "release_url": "https://pypi.org/project/python-logentries-api/0.7/", "requires_dist": null, "requires_python": null, "summary": "A python wrapper for the Logentries API", "version": "0.7" }, "last_serial": 1694883,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"6615a0af70eef311ffa88bed16097d80", "sha256": "017622cc74b8a9501e3890aac894c005a458937e0180f5acd02374fc2b10bf07" }, "downloads": -1, "filename": "python_logentries_api-0.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"6615a0af70eef311ffa88bed16097d80", "packagetype": "bdist_wheel", "python_version": "3.4", "requires_python": null, "size": 14292, "upload_time": "2015-08-12T17:36:23", "url": "https://files.pythonhosted.org/packages/d8/1b/e84f083e60bb58a5335b3d1fccb7d5b80c771d009e829786065f9b0e3794/python_logentries_api-0.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"8368c4302b9a348a30fbdd698d038c85", "sha256": "56a5c936f36f78ac946dd6fd12f9719975d7d24ccbcfe0c05d89e0cc752c89ee" }, "downloads": -1, "filename": "python-logentries-api-0.1.tar.gz", "has_sig": false, "md5_digest": "8368c4302b9a348a30fbdd698d038c85",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 9835, "upload_time": "2015-08-12T17:36:19", "url": "https://files.pythonhosted.org/packages/c9/ec/0b814dfb11c7b4152e04d0676eeceab118aeddf9f154a82e8d60e59aac46/python-logentries-api-0.1.tar.gz"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"9b11e4d3c02e9b0de8bb0adb2202432d", "sha256": "ee4f38d079a1d37a12324045cb009729e2a260bfdd25e2871ed7b8fb995303c4" }, "downloads": -1, "filename": "python_logentries_api-0.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"9b11e4d3c02e9b0de8bb0adb2202432d", "packagetype": "bdist_wheel", "python_version": "3.4", "requires_python": null, "size": 14991, "upload_time": "2015-08-13T17:26:57", "url": "https://files.pythonhosted.org/packages/59/80/ac22181cf5eda6be7f46a95342d23730fd5ee8cb45c14b092b5a92031fa4/python_logentries_api-0.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"c99d552b7d3a5a469542355e47696a6a", "sha256": "fdfcc2fe0e71c205555aa07c8770c3a74c063a28cc7f47bf978453e56eab0051" }, "downloads": -1, "filename": "python-logentries-api-0.2.tar.gz", "has_sig": false, "md5_digest": "c99d552b7d3a5a469542355e47696a6a",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7572, "upload_time": "2015-08-13T17:26:54", "url": "https://files.pythonhosted.org/packages/53/52/d8d68be7000b4563b3ca203c3f418c1a695389d20831962da3a8db1f9038/python-logentries-api-0.2.tar.gz" } ], "0.3": [ { "comment_text": "", "digests": { "md5": "9734aafc86e3959ee309b6aa42163de5", "sha256": "1e1647b042dea063a44553964969e7137ebded2cd061a21589ed35d050a7d230" }, "downloads": -1, "filename": "python_logentries_api-0.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"9734aafc86e3959ee309b6aa42163de5",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 15658, "upload_time": "2015-08-13T20:07:32", "url": "https://files.pythonhosted.org/packages/8a/fc/d7d1c346e5eb73c54e695438e7eb78f2b68c66d9bc36fcba52fee4602e70/python_logentries_api-0.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"561889619244f86c780b371891cdc6fc", "sha256": "eee25ce0c784b17f4bc65bf140bbfcffba17093918680741768e0bec4f54cb2c" }, "downloads": -1, "filename": "python-logentries-api-0.3.tar.gz", "has_sig": false, "md5_digest": "561889619244f86c780b371891cdc6fc",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 8256, "upload_time": "2015-08-13T20:07:29", "url": "https://files.pythonhosted.org/packages/9a/af/35f05c213070d210ea7debb89cc7b520dd749b435afc5b7f647f367d49db/python-logentries-api-0.3.tar.gz" } ], "0.4": [ { "comment_text": "", "digests": { "md5": "335137343024cf2408f9e90ca6f62cc5", "sha256": "b49343eacecd2a6dce79c60d406c9f673a49fdc823c36acc25e27d70ee26ac1c" }, "downloads": -1, "filename": "python_logentries_api-0.4-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"335137343024cf2408f9e90ca6f62cc5", "packagetype": "bdist_wheel", "python_version": "3.4", "requires_python": null, "size": 16936, "upload_time": "2015-08-21T15:15:15", "url": "https://files.pythonhosted.org/packages/9d/7b/5ea217e155b0ee7e1ab1e4a54b9a1cc3ee3e58e41e71132749d60657b284/python_logentries_api-0.4-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"02c0474bad4b4ca4cb5ca97bbc268cdb", "sha256": "500ba0fc4d60ef3550965b43db1d9e77ad0078bae701544fbf166c3dbc3efa2b" }, "downloads": -1, "filename": "python-logentries-api-0.4.tar.gz", "has_sig": false, "md5_digest": "02c0474bad4b4ca4cb5ca97bbc268cdb",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 8882, "upload_time": "2015-08-21T15:15:11", "url": "https://files.pythonhosted.org/packages/48/2b/670854e602c16bf8197f4334b570ce1fc77497021000345f1db67099da88/python-logentries-api-0.4.tar.gz" } ], "0.5": [ { "comment_text": "", "digests": { "md5": "54c8e3af04ca991bc4a52819514cd40d", "sha256": "e7703d7ffc6b48d4aa64664229c3dacd6d4b6a490ca328d0581b8f62b17c4727" }, "downloads": -1, "filename": "python_logentries_api-0.5-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"54c8e3af04ca991bc4a52819514cd40d",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 24361, "upload_time": "2015-08-24T21:11:19", "url": "https://files.pythonhosted.org/packages/42/3d/4046f27e66128ee4e05e74e93bd42410e1f60f29799ebf9cd89e92f51a70/python_logentries_api-0.5-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"99af4a0dcb020fc6e1bc4d030c4f4f7b", "sha256": "951238b7c7d9c14ad787731e2def519137debc55049c5fa87a173c77e63c1cd2" }, "downloads": -1, "filename": "python-logentries-api-0.5.tar.gz", "has_sig": false, "md5_digest": "99af4a0dcb020fc6e1bc4d030c4f4f7b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12519, "upload_time": "2015-08-24T21:11:00", "url": "https://files.pythonhosted.org/packages/17/52/d38858c9dd3621e743deeffbfd7b09e1a58db3d283382e3ffbbae32340c3/python-logentries-api-0.5.tar.gz" } ], "0.6": [ { "comment_text": "", "digests": { "md5": "11c675c49d0f473858e7e6e516100e2f", "sha256": "960b48cd5dba7872ffc6b3feedc70fe5ecbbe2d886af0e87aff20f4ab5acdef5" }, "downloads": -1, "filename": "python_logentries_api-0.6-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"11c675c49d0f473858e7e6e516100e2f",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 25277, "upload_time": "2015-08-25T14:44:52", "url": "https://files.pythonhosted.org/packages/ee/2e/b094459ef95c07bb56465084d20ba85180a6eed4a5c6fad954828fa0c56a/python_logentries_api-0.6-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"ba541883a3e523b2a0848d0f98e70ef9", "sha256": "86e29d4f02d06aa0d8abb43675bc4bb918f5da60d2acbfd7de74d3ab611de04a" }, "downloads": -1, "filename": "python-logentries-api-0.6.tar.gz", "has_sig": false, "md5_digest": "ba541883a3e523b2a0848d0f98e70ef9",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12753, "upload_time": "2015-08-25T14:44:47", "url": "https://files.pythonhosted.org/packages/81/0b/231b108eac8bf903025e987c6ca8ece743ec2ed3e6886634440436a1f145/python-logentries-api-0.6.tar.gz" } ], "0.7": [ { "comment_text": "", "digests": { "md5": "8ef90e0db0fbea2fe2799384655565cf", "sha256": "9468ab88340eae94fde94c84b3d23b5d3ba1bbc7c458a20ff0ab99fffba7b4ac" }, "downloads": -1, "filename": "python_logentries_api-0.7-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8ef90e0db0fbea2fe2799384655565cf",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 25744, "upload_time": "2015-08-26T16:42:12", "url": "https://files.pythonhosted.org/packages/c3/40/5d9e3db53bb00f3e5bb1fddbae5af72ca223b8486432bb49983723a6717c/python_logentries_api-0.7-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"e71ec4d09ff85f7ec263b4da8d18e758", "sha256": "f7db0a8518d3b7be5d7c52b9dbc6bc85fd6e049f5861f6c280d49cf26a251ab4" }, "downloads": -1, "filename": "python-logentries-api-0.7.tar.gz", "has_sig": false, "md5_digest": "e71ec4d09ff85f7ec263b4da8d18e758",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12961, "upload_time": "2015-08-26T16:42:09", "url": "https://files.pythonhosted.org/packages/b5/81/18bd06e91b8ff142e113196ae7382258c7c27f695a4e3e7c3b8949ed3424/python-logentries-api-0.7.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"8ef90e0db0fbea2fe2799384655565cf", "sha256": "9468ab88340eae94fde94c84b3d23b5d3ba1bbc7c458a20ff0ab99fffba7b4ac" }, "downloads": -1, "filename": "python_logentries_api-0.7-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"8ef90e0db0fbea2fe2799384655565cf",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 25744, "upload_time": "2015-08-26T16:42:12", "url": "https://files.pythonhosted.org/packages/c3/40/5d9e3db53bb00f3e5bb1fddbae5af72ca223b8486432bb49983723a6717c/python_logentries_api-0.7-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"e71ec4d09ff85f7ec263b4da8d18e758", "sha256": "f7db0a8518d3b7be5d7c52b9dbc6bc85fd6e049f5861f6c280d49cf26a251ab4" }, "downloads": -1, "filename": "python-logentries-api-0.7.tar.gz", "has_sig": false, "md5_digest": "e71ec4d09ff85f7ec263b4da8d18e758",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12961, "upload_time": "2015-08-26T16:42:09", "url": "https://files.pythonhosted.org/packages/b5/81/18bd06e91b8ff142e113196ae7382258c7c27f695a4e3e7c3b8949ed3424/python-logentries-api-0.7.tar.gz" } ] }